What companies run services between Winchester, England and Caen, France?

You can take a train from Winchester to Caen via London Waterloo Station, Waterloo station, Euston station, London St Pancras Intl, Paris Nord, Magenta, Haussmann Saint-Lazare, and Paris St Lazare in around 6h 37m. Alternatively, Brittany Ferries operates a ferry from Portsmouth to Caen - Ouistreham every 4 hours. Tickets cost €35–70 and the journey takes 6h.
